Ogilvy & Mather Shanghai appoints Jeffery Cheng and Emiko Nagai to its senior management team

| | No Comments

Jeffery Cheng_2.jpgOgilvy & Mather Group Shanghai has made two appointments to its senior management team. Jeffery Cheng (pictured top left) has been named National Head of Social@Ogilvy, a cross-discipline team of social experts from across all of O&M China’s businesses, and Emiko Nagai (pictured bottom left) joins the company as Regional Business Director of O&M Group/Asia Pacific.

In this newly created role, Cheng is charged with consolidating O&M’s social media offerings in China, building thought leadership and expanding the agency’s business in the dynamic and crucial battleground of social media. Cheng will be leading social initiatives for clients to build their brands and businesses.

Emiko Nagai.jpgWith more than 15 years of experience in digital marketing, Cheng is an avid social marketing evangelist in Taiwan and mainland China. His last position was as General Manager of the China East Office of Chinese social networking service Renren for three and a half years. Prior to that, Cheng helped pioneer online marketing in Taiwan during his eight-year tenure at Yahoo! Taiwan. He has led innovative projects in both the Taiwanese and mainland Chinese markets with international brands including Unilever, Coca-Cola, Johnson & Johnson and more.

At the same time, Emiko Nagai has also joined the company as Regional Business Director of O&M Group/Asia Pacific, where she is the new brand team leader of one of O&M Shanghai’s largest clients, IHG. Nagai will replace Alex Lee, who has transitioned into the role of Regional Digital Director, O&M Group/Asia Pacific based in Hong Kong.

As the 360 Degree team leader on all IHG brands in the Greater China region, Nagai will focus on the client’s integrated brand strategy ranging from digital communications to customer relationship management (CRM). She will also oversee IHG’s global coordination across Asia  and the Middle East.

Hailing from an international background, Nagai was born in Japan, grew up in Brazil and

educated in the US. She has 15 years of experience in multiple Asian markets across Japan, Hong Kong and mainland China, where she spent four years at TBWA China working with clients such as Michelin, Tencent, McDonald’s and Star Elite. Before that Nagai was with Leo Burnett in Hong Kong and Japan for 11 years as the Group Brand Director for SKII and Rejoice – two brands that she successfully helped to establish in the Greater China market.
